Bladder cancer: Early bladder cancer has very few symptoms. Blood in the urine is the reason for initial evaluation of people subsequently diagnosed with bladder tumors. The definitive test remains cystoscopy. This must be performed by a qualified urologist. It can, however, usually be performed in the office.
